The record

What the Middlesex County, Massachusetts severe weather history record shows

Across the archive, Middlesex County, Massachusetts severe weather history averages 16.2 recorded events a year. The busiest stretch on record is the 2010s, with 439 events logged in that decade alone. Roughly 74 events fall before 1990 and 1,060 from 1990 onward — a gap that reflects the expansion of NOAA reporting practice as much as the weather itself.

The deadliest hazard in the Middlesex County, Massachusetts record is lightning, responsible for 1 direct deaths. The costliest is flood, with $41.7M in reported property damage. In total, 8 distinct hazard types appear in this county archive, each listed with its own dated record below.

Tornado tracks

Paths crossing this county

24 mapped tornado paths intersect this county: 20 touched down inside it and 4 crossed in from a neighbouring county. This comes from path geometry, not county-tagged reports.
